Terms in this set (15)
Hide definitions
What does the mnemonic SOHCAHTOA help you remember in trigonometry?
SOHCAHTOA helps you remember that sine is opposite over hypotenuse, cosine is adjacent over hypotenuse, and tangent is opposite over adjacent.
How do you find the sine of an angle in a right triangle?
You divide the length of the side opposite the angle by the length of the hypotenuse.
What is the formula for the cosine of an angle in a right triangle?
Cosine is the length of the adjacent side divided by the length of the hypotenuse.
How is the tangent of an angle in a right triangle calculated?
Tangent is the length of the side opposite the angle divided by the length of the adjacent side.
What is the relationship between tangent, sine, and cosine?
Tangent of an angle equals the sine of the angle divided by the cosine of the angle.
What are the reciprocal trigonometric functions and their relationships?
Cosecant is the reciprocal of sine, secant is the reciprocal of cosine, and cotangent is the reciprocal of tangent.
How do you find the cosecant of an angle in a right triangle?
Cosecant is the hypotenuse divided by the side opposite the angle.
What is the formula for the secant of an angle in a right triangle?
Secant is the hypotenuse divided by the side adjacent to the angle.
How is cotangent of an angle defined in terms of triangle sides?
Cotangent is the length of the adjacent side divided by the length of the opposite side.
What is an inverse trigonometric function used for?
An inverse trigonometric function is used to find the angle when you know the value of a trigonometric ratio.
What is another name for inverse trigonometric functions?
Inverse trigonometric functions are also called arc functions, such as arcsine or arctangent.
How do you isolate an angle using a trigonometric equation like sin(θ) = 6/13?
You take the inverse sine of both sides, so θ = sin⁻¹(6/13).
What must you check on your calculator before evaluating a trigonometric function?
You must check that your calculator is in the correct mode: degrees for degree problems and radians for radian problems.
How do you calculate secant or cosecant on a calculator if there is no direct button?
You use the reciprocal identity: secant is 1 divided by cosine, and cosecant is 1 divided by sine.
How do you access an inverse trigonometric function on a calculator?
You press the 'second' button and then the corresponding trig function button to access the inverse function.
